Be quick to function: Handlebars really should be straightforward to turn, if expected, and brakes should be effortless to apply, to decelerate on hills. A lighter scooter might be simpler for the toddler to implement, Primarily as They may be determining how to steer. (And an older child may possibly discover a lighter product fewer of the literal drag.)

Weight performs a task likewise. A fifty-pound child may have a tough time damaging most scooters, but a full-sized Grownup can bend the frame in only one unplanned detour off a curb. When unsure, have support executed or switch the scooter. Slipping in your confront at 10 miles per hour is usually a Substantially greater offer than one particular may Assume.

In accordance with the AAP suggestions, children beneath 16 must not operate or trip over a motorized e-scooter. And naturally, irrespective of their age, everyone need to have on a helmet when Driving. Fat and Peak Boundaries: Every scooter incorporates a excess weight limitation determined by its materials and wheel measurement, and it’s imperative that you regard these figures. Body weight maximums range between designs, with some capping at 220 pounds. Most of the lesser plastic products have fifty-pound bodyweight limits, supporting a young age selection. Materials: Non-electric powered scooters are generally fabricated from aluminum, metal, or titanium. Even though aluminum scooters may carry a significant cost tag, they boast a lighter frame which may make Driving much more at ease, and they're perfect for kids to maneuver and carry for the duration of their rides. In spite of its material, the scooter should really truly feel strong and durable. Range and Sizing of Wheels: A few-wheeled scooters offer additional steadiness than two-wheeled scooters and so are your best option for young kids, Based on Pasin.
